[Instant News/Comprehensive Report] Since the United States issued a travel "safety warning" to Turkey, other European countries have followed suit and temporarily closed their consulates in Istanbul. For this reason, Turkish Interior Minister Suleyman Soylu criticized the US ambassador for trying to Wind direction hurts Turkey.

According to comprehensive media reports, the U.S. Consulate in Istanbul warned on January 30: "Terrorists may carry out retaliatory attacks on churches, synagogues and diplomatic missions in Istanbul or places frequently visited by Westerners." Not only issued travel warnings, but also closed consulates.

Other countries have followed suit. So far, at least seven European countries including Germany and France have temporarily closed their consulates in Istanbul.

According to reports, Solu challenged the US ambassador yesterday (3rd), "Please take your dirty hands away from Turkey." Solu further accused Turkey of knowing what the United States was planning and intending to lead the way to create chaos in Turkey.

It is reported that the Turkish Ministry of Foreign Affairs on Thursday (2nd) issued a series of terrorist threat notices in response to the consulates of nine countries including the United States, and urgently summoned the ambassadors of these nine countries.

However, Turkish Foreign Minister Mevlut Cavusoglu vehemently denied it, saying the threat notification did not exist.
